Reference Type Series
Output Type Fixed
Min/Fixed Output Voltage 2.048V
Output Current 500μA
Tolerance ±0.49%
Temperature Coefficient 25ppm/°C
Noise - 0.1Hz to 10Hz 40μVp-p
Noise - 10Hz to 10kHz 105μVrms
Parts Input Voltage (V) 2.5V ~ 12.6V
Supply Current 35μA
Temperature Range - Operating -40°C ~ 85°C
Mounting Style SMD
Manufacturer Package 8-SOIC
Supplier Device Package 8-SOIC
